Skip to content

Update config structure for record review requests #2305

@palkerecsenyi

Description

@palkerecsenyi

Right now, the config for record reviews is quite minimal. We should update this structure in a way that is as backward-compatible as possible, while adding support for configuring how new versions trigger review requests.

See inveniosoftware/product-rdm#241 for a more precise description of the intended functionality.


For this issue, we should implement the necessary changes to the config on the backend (without the rest of the functionality) in a backward-compatible way (preferably).

Importantly, the existing default behaviour should be unchanged. Without changes to configuration, the current behaviour (the first bullet point) should apply.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    Status

    In review 🔍

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ions